About This Home
This charming single-story home offers four bedrooms and two bathrooms,along with a two-car garage and an attractive split floor plan. Situated in a growing area near XNA Airport and the Walmart Distribution Center,it belongs to the well-regarded Bentonville School District. The home is equipped with solar panels for energy efficiency and includes a covered patio that is perfect for outdoor relaxation. It also features numerous thoughtful upgrades throughout,highlighted by three elegant archways and beautiful plank wood flooring. The spacious master suite includes an oversized walk-in closet,and the refrigerator,washer,and dryer are included. Credit & Background check required. MLS ID 1359372

Bentonville, Arkansas combines small-town living with metropolitan amenities. As the headquarters of Walmart, the city has evolved into a cultural destination, anchored by Crystal Bridges Museum of American Art. Housing options span from downtown apartments to residential communities, with one-bedroom units averaging $1,139 and two-bedroom homes at $1,337. The rental market shows moderate growth, with year-over-year increases of 2.5% for one-bedroom and 3.7% for two-bedroom units.
The city center buzzes with activity, while neighborhoods like Third Street and West Central Avenue showcase historic architecture and tree-lined streets. Downtown features the Walmart Museum, housed in the original Walton's Five and Dime building. Outdoor enthusiasts appreciate Bentonville's extensive trail network, including the Razorback Regional Greenway and the Slaughter Pen Mountain Bike Park.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
